CalAmp’s patent involves using machine learning to detect abnormal driving behavior through vehicle telematics data. The system calculates a driver risk score and can engage safety systems based on identified anomalies. This innovation aims to enhance vehicle safety by proactively addressing risky driving behaviors. Vehicle safety system based on driver risk score

Source: United States Patent and Trademark Office (USPTO). Credit: CalAmp Corp

The granted patent (Publication Number: US11919523B2) discloses a method for engaging a vehicle safety system based on driver risk score and data received from a vehicle telematics device. The method involves identifying safety violations, generating safety control signals, and engaging safety systems such as reducing engine rotations, applying brakes, shifting gears, or even disabling the vehicle temporarily. Additionally, the safety system can instruct an autonomous driving system to take over and drive the vehicle to a safe location, or alert the driver through visual or audio cues of unsafe driving behavior.

Furthermore, the method includes disengaging the safety system once it has responded to the safety control signal, and utilizes machine learning processes to calculate driver risk scores based on anomalies in the telematics data. The safety violations are identified by comparing data to reference threshold values, which are dependent on the driver risk score. The method also allows for generating multiple safety control signals to engage different safety systems, confirming their responses through sensor data, and subsequently disengaging them once the response is confirmed. Overall, the patent outlines a comprehensive approach to enhancing vehicle safety through real-time monitoring and intervention based on driver behavior and risk assessment.
